Southwest Valley Constructors Co was awarded a federal contract by Department Of Defense (Department Of The Army) on May 15, 2019 for $1.86 billion of work in highway, street, and bridge construction. Performance is in Tucson, AZ. It was awarded under full and open competition. The contract has been modified 31 times since the base award It uses firm fixed-price contract pricing. The most recent modification was on September 5, 2025.
